Tree Surgery Huntingdon for Pruning, Crown Work and Safety
Tree Surgery Huntingdon covers many specialist tasks, including crown reduction, crown thinning, crown lifting, deadwood removal and controlled branch management. Crown reduction helps cut back the size of a tree while preserving a natural form. Crown thinning allows more light and air to pass through the branches, which can benefit gardens that feel dark or enclosed. Crown lifting removes lower limbs to improve access, sightlines and clearance beneath the tree.
Deadwood removal is another key part of safe tree care. Dead branches can fall without warning, especially during high winds or heavy rain. Taking them out helps protect people, cars, roofs, sheds and neighbouring property. In many cases, routine inspections and maintenance can prevent bigger issues from developing. A professional approach ensures the work is completed safely, with the right equipment and consideration for the surrounding space.
Tree Removal Huntingdon for Difficult or Unsafe Trees
Sometimes pruning is not enough, and Tree Removal Huntingdon becomes the safest choice. A tree may need to be removed if it is dead, badly diseased, structurally unstable, storm damaged or growing in a position that creates serious problems. Removal may also be needed when roots affect surfaces, when a tree has outgrown a small space or when renovation plans require a clearer layout.
Removing a tree should always be handled with care. It may involve controlled cutting, safe lowering of branches, sectional dismantling and careful clearing of waste. Surrounding buildings, fences, planting and access routes must all be considered before work starts. Gardening Huntingdon for Healthy Lawns, Neat Hedges and Planting
A healthy garden relies on balance. Lawns need routine cutting and edging to stay tidy. Hedges need trimming to maintain shape and prevent them from blocking paths, windows or neighbouring spaces. Shrubs and plants need pruning at the correct time to encourage growth and flowering. Gardening Huntingdon services can combine these tasks into one practical maintenance plan.
Good gardening is also about understanding how different areas of a garden work together. A shaded corner may need different planting compared with a sunny border. A busy family garden may need durable grass and low-maintenance shrubs. A front garden may need a simple, clean look that improves the first impression of the property. With the right support, even a tired garden can become easier to manage and more enjoyable to use.
